Azerbaijan, Baku, March 11 / Trend T. Konyayeva /
In 2009 the trade turnover between Azerbaijan and Germany reached 2 billion euros. Now they implement six joint projects, Germany's Ambassador to Azerbaijan Per Stankina said at the Center for Strategic Studies today.
"Economic cooperation between Azerbaijan and Germany is developing very dynamically. Germany has recently become a very important economic partner of Azerbaijan", ambassador said.
German RWE signed the memorandum of understanding with SOCAR in Baku yesterday to develop offshore perspective structure "Nakhchivan". It is a participant of Nabucco gas pipeline project, designed to transport natural gas from Central Asia and the Caspian Sea to European markets.
"Nabucco is a priority for us among all other energy projects", ambassador said.
The construction of the gas pipeline is scheduled for 2011. The first deliveries are planned to be launched in 2014. Maximum capacity of the pipeline will amount to 31 billion cubic meters a year.
